About Jeffrey
Jeff Ritter is one of the original partners of the firm. He practices in the area of transactional law, with an emphasis in banking, commercial lending, commercial real estate and corporate organizations and acquisitions. He has represented numerous national and regional lenders and institutional syndicated groups in connection with structured oil and gas, agricultural and commercial financings.
He has represented numerous financial institutions in initial financings and multi-party restructurings. He currently represents a regional lender in its role as trustee of nationwide bond issues.
Mr. Ritter practiced corporate and securities law in Oklahoma City for ten years before moving to Amarillo in 1989. He has extensive experience in public and private securities offerings, including oil and gas, real estate and other commercial ventures. Mr. Ritter currently represents a major university in the review of the legal aspects of its endowment investment portfolio. He has handled securities arbitration matters and has served as an arbitrator on both New York and American Stock Exchange arbitration panels.
Mr. Ritter is a member of the Texas Association of Bank Counsel and is a member of the State Bar of Texas, the Oklahoma Bar Association, the American Bar Association and the Amarillo Bar Association.
Mr. Ritter received his B.S. degree in Accounting from Oklahoma State University in May 1976 and his J.D. degree from the University of Oklahoma in May 1979. While in law school, he served as Editor of the Oklahoma Law Review.
